The Parity Paradox | Why Any Team Can (Potentially) Win

For years, the NFL was dominated by dynasties – the Patriots, the Steelers, the 49ers. But lately? It feels like anyone can beat anyone on any given Sunday. But, is this a good thing? This parity, spurred by free agency and the salary cap, creates nail-biting finishes. I’ve been following this for years and a common mistake I see is that people think the old dynasties will return. Nope. The new NFL game favors quick rebuilds and exploiting matchups. A team can go from worst to first faster than ever before. What fascinates me is the psychological impact on players and fans alike. Every week is a pressure cooker.

The increased parity also means we’re seeing more unpredictable outcomes and strategic innovation. Teams are forced to adapt and evolve constantly, leading to a more dynamic and engaging viewing experience. This constant competition fosters a sense of excitement and anticipation, as fans eagerly await each game to see which team will rise to the occasion and secure a crucial victory. Rule Changes & Player Safety | The Constant Tug-of-War

The NFL is constantly tweaking its rules, ostensibly in the name of player safety. But these changes inevitably impact the game’s flow and strategy. Some purists argue that the rules are softening the game, while others maintain they’re necessary to protect players’ long-term health. The NFL’s evolving rules are a hotly debated topic. According to league officials, these adjustments aim to balance safety and competition. What I initially thought was straightforward has become a complex calculus of risk and reward.

It’s fascinating to watch how coaches and players adapt to these changes. New techniques emerge, strategies shift, and the game evolves. But the fundamental question remains: are these changes truly making the game safer, or are they simply altering its character? The Analytics Revolution | Data vs. Gut Feeling

The analytics revolution has swept through the NFL, with teams increasingly relying on data to make informed decisions. From draft picks to in-game strategy, numbers are playing a bigger role than ever before. But does this mean that gut feeling and experience are becoming obsolete? Not necessarily. The best teams find a way to blend data with intuition.

A common mistake I see people make is over-reliance on analytics without considering the human element. Football is a game of emotion, momentum, and unpredictable events. Data can provide insights, but it can’t predict everything. The true art lies in interpreting the data, understanding its limitations, and making informed decisions that account for the intangible aspects of the game.
